The lamination of the masseter muscle in 21 Japanese serows of different sexes and ages was studied by the method of Yoshikawa et al. who proposed a lamination theory for this muscle. The masseter muscle in the Japanese serow was found to be composed of I) the proper masseter muscle which included 1) the first superficial, 2) the second superficial, 3) the intermediate and 4) the deep masseter muscles, in which the deep masseter muscle could be subdivided into a pars anterior and pars posterior and II) the improper masseter muscle which included 5) the maxillomandibular and 6) the zygomaticomandibular muscles, in which the maxillomandibular muscle was further divided into first and second layers. These findings indicate that the lamination of the masseter muscle in the Japanese serow is the same as that in the goat and sheep.
